What Are Paylines In Online Slots?

Paylines are a crucial component of online slots, defining how players win in a game. Essentially, a payline is a line that crosses various symbols on the reels, and if players land matching symbols along this line, they achieve a win. Traditionally, paylines were horizontal, but modern online slots can feature vertical, diagonal, and even crisscrossing patterns, offering varied ways to win.

The number of paylines in a slot can range from as few as one to hundreds, or even thousands in some games. Some slots allow players to choose how many paylines to activate, while others have fixed paylines that must be played in total. Understanding paylines helps players strategize their bets, as more active paylines generally increase the chance of winning, although they may also require higher stakes.
